SolidWorks >> Makra >> Usuwanie ozn. gwintu i faz makrem
Autor Wypowiedź
CSWP, CSWE, CSWI *** solid-blog.pl ***
2016-04-19, 11:52
Pomógł 406 raz(y).
Koledzy,
podpowiedzcie czy da się makrem wyszukać i usunąć w dxf otwory z fazą i oznaczenia gwintu w blachach?

Albo może to działać na zasadzie konfiguracji w modelu, gdzie makro wygasi fazki na otworach (żeby nie było dwóch okręgów w rzucie, tylko jeden - wewn.) oraz wygasi oznaczenia gwintu.
 
.
2016-04-19, 12:29
Pomógł 52 raz(y).
W DXF można by próbować odnaleźć współśrodkowe okręgi i usunąć wszystkie z wyjątkiem najmniejszego. Tylko co zrobić jeśli blacha jest współśrodkowym kołem?
Jeśli chodzi o oznaczenia gwintu to może mapowaniem DXF-DWG podczas eksportu.
Wyłączanie operacji fazowania wydaje się możliwe ale pod warunkiem, że nie jest zrobione nietypowo np. wycięciem przez obrót, albo kreatorem otworów.
 
2016-04-20, 02:37
Pomógł 36 raz(y).
Witam.

Jeśli pogłębienia, fazki są tylko na jednej ścianie, to robiąc dxf, trzeba zaznaczyć drugą ścianę (przeciwną).

Ta opcja nie zadziała, jeśli blacha jest z perforacją.
 
.
2016-04-20, 07:45
Pomógł 52 raz(y).
Ja to robię ręcznie. Gwinty to prosta sprawa bo wybieram filtr 'Oznaczenie gwintu' i oknem ukrywam wszystkie. Gorzej z krawędziami, bo tu trzeba cierpliwie wyklikać wszystkie niepotrzebne.
 
Wykonam każde makro w SolidWorks
2016-04-20, 22:42
Pomógł 12 raz(y).
Witam,
Znany temat ;) Mam makro, które przed wygenerowaniem zamienia otwory z pogłębieniami na "zwykłe" o odpowiedniej średnicy a otwory nieprzelotowe wygasza. Podeślesz model do testów? Ewentualnie szybie dostosowanie i mamy rozwiązanie.
 
Zibi
2016-11-25, 10:22
Pomógł 0 raz(y).
Witam

na co dzień borykam się z takimi przypadkami pogłębienia stożkowe, otwory gwintowane itp.

Informacje jak sobie z tym szybko i sprawnie poradzić mile widziane. Dla mnie najlepszym rozwiązaniem jest widok na rysunku detalu (blachy) bez tych wszystkich elementów, w przypadku pogłębień stożkowych tylko otwór o małej średnicy, aby później zrobić z tego plik DXF

 
.
2016-11-25, 10:46
Pomógł 52 raz(y).
Najlepiej tworząc model, który będzie blachą wcześniej to przewidzieć (można utworzyć odpowiedni szablon). Wtedy sfazowania, pogłębienia, gwinty i inne elementy, które nie powinny się znaleźć na rozwinięciu blachy do cięcia CNC (laser,woda) umieszczamy w innej konfiguracji.
Jedno kliknięcie i mamy gotowy profil do eksportu na DXF.
 
Zibi
2016-11-25, 11:01
Pomógł 0 raz(y).
szkopuł w tym że ja tego nie tworze (rozbieram na elementy pierwsze przygotowując detale do upalenia) dostaje gotowe rysunki, modele a możliwości Solida plus wyobraźnia konstruktorów daje nieskończenie wiele wariatów i możliwości i muszę nad tym zapanować aby sobie życie ułatwić. Najgorsze są pogłębienia stożkowe nie wiem jak w prosty sposób szybko wygenerować model z małymi średnicami np. w innej konfiguracji.
 
2016-11-25, 23:01
Pomógł 36 raz(y).
Witam.

Nie wiem w jaki sposób robicie DXF, lub DWG do palenia laserem , plazmą, czy też wycinaniem wodą. Ja (miarką do mierzenia - zmierz, - w opcjach "oceń") klikam na ścianę - płaszczyznę, (bez względu na ustawienie (pod jakim jest kątem) i zapisuję w danym formacie (DXF lub DWG, jak na rys. po niżej, + dodaje ( tym wypadku) ściany pogłębienia, a w programie DraftSight usuwam zewnętrzne okręgi. W programie jak i w DraftSight widzi to, co faktycznie ma wypalić lub wyciąć. I w tym wypatku nie ma znaczenia pogłębienie czy, też faska.



Pozdrawiam
 
.
2016-11-28, 09:03
Pomógł 52 raz(y).
Kiedyś, gdy pracowałem w AutoCadzie to pisałem sobie różne pomoce w AutoLispie i miałem też takie, które wyciągało dane o otworach na powierzchni. Ale niestety DraftSight nie ma Lispa, a przynajmniej ja o tym nie wiem. Można by spróbować zrobić makro pod SW, które by to robiło na pliku DXF.
Ale do tego potrzebna jest motywacja i vena twórcza :D no i trochę wolnego czasu. Puki co wolę obrabiać rysunki w SW przed eksportem do DXF czy DWG, nie jest to wcale takie bardzo upierdliwe.
 
Zibi
2016-11-28, 12:42
Pomógł 0 raz(y).
Ja tez obrabiam rysunki w SW przed eksportem do DXF i te pogłębienia sprzedają mi sen z powiek bo jak się trafi kilka elementów po kilkanaście albo i kilkadziesiąt szt. otworów to się można za klikać na amen. Szukam jakiegoś prostego sposobu na zmianę tego na otwory cylindryczne w modelu jak by się to dało to później można by pomyśleć o automatyzacji (VBA) tego procesu
 

PSWUG

Strefa Resellera

Publikuj

Społeczność

Ankieta

Linki

RSS

BOT